100 Jobs Here, 100 Jobs There, 45 Jobs Here....Sound Like A Recovery To You?
Well Not quite, but hey you gotta start somewhere, Right? These are recent job announcements made in the Triangle recently and while not huge numbers they represent positive news from companies in Technology, Drug Manufacturing and Data Processing.
SAS announced it would hire 100 new employees in Cary for it's SAS Analytic Lab for State and Local Government. The lab has been designed to provide data analysis for state and local government groups that must deal with budget shortfalls in 2011 and beyond.
HTC Corp maker of the smart phone the Droid will hire 45 people for it's new location in Durham. This quote from Ron Louks,Chief Strategy Officer for HTC sums up why so many high tech companies choose the Triangle "Durham is a perfect place to open our new R&D office because we are able to tap into this deep pool of technical talent that complements HTC's leading-edge R&D efforts going on around the world."
Novartis, the Swiss drug maker will add a development lab at it's Holly Springs flu vaccine plant. they will hire approximately 100 people whose jobs will pay an average of $106,000.
